To be honest I don't understand the logic of spending the money that could go towards the 8700k on added premium for the motherboard. It makes absolutely zero sense in terms of features.

The motherboard will give you precisely zero % performance. The 8700k has the potential of double the thread count.

As for the rest: RAM kit, good choice. PSU, not sure but doesn't look bad, I suppose the RGB pulled you to this model. GPU: where is it? Last but not least: The X62 Kraken has not been getting the best feedback on the pumps. DOA rate seems to be high, worth waiting out a few months. I was going to grab one too, its sexy as f, but this turned me off bigtime.

https://www.reddit.com/r/NZXT/

Skim through the threads, they are quite numerous and this is a new (Asetek) pump.

I just read you push GTX 1080 x2. OK. Then definitely the i7 route, unless you like your platform upgrade before your next SLI setup.
